# Fan-out backpressure settings for the Chirpline notifier.
# Plugin authors: if your handler is slow, the dispatcher queues
# events in the overflow table instead of dropping them. Tune
# max_inflight and drain_batch here, but don't zero them out or
# the drainer spins. The overflow table lives in the database
# reachable via the connection string below.

replica DSN, yahaf-yagaf: mongodb://tamath_svc:a2netSk3RZMuTj@db-d084.novacsoft.internal:5432/ralmir

Hey Priya — handing off the thumbnail queue (Snapcrush) before I'm out. Short version: the resizer workers on the Veldt cluster have been flaky since the libvips bump, so I doubled the retry window and drained the dead-letter queue this morning. If backlog climbs past ~5k, just scale the workers to six and it clears in an hour. Marek from the media team knows the history if you need context. Everything else runs off the values below, so check them first before touching anything.

settings of fafog-haduf:
ZORIX_PIN=4648
ZORIX_METRICS_HOST=metrics.zorix.paliqsys.corp
ZORIX_LOG_LEVEL=info
ZORIX_TENANT=druix

# ChipGate reader client — Velodrome Relay release notes apply.
# Connects to the PaceWire ingest service to stream timing-chip reads
# from the Harlowe City Marathon mats. Retry logic is fixed at three
# attempts; do not tune per-release. Firmware older than 4.2 drops
# packets under load, so gate the rollout on mat firmware checks.
# Staging and prod use separate ingest endpoints; this block is prod.
# The client authenticates against the PaceWire internal service using
# the key below.

gateway credential: kto3_qfe

Welcome to the Bricklane build migration! We're moving the Quartzline pipeline over to Hermetiq, our hermetic build system, which means no more "works on my machine" tickets for you folks. All toolchains are pinned, caches are sealed, and outputs are reproducible bit-for-bit. If a customer reports a stale artifact, just re-trigger the sealed build — don't patch locally. To unlock the migration vault during escalations, you'll need the recovery passphrase, which is shown directly below.

vault phrase of kawep-tahog = ulaix-briath